    I have a crock pot recipe that I found on recipe zaar...the whole family loves it...

    1 (16 ounce) can pinto beans
    1 (16 ounce) can white beans or kidney beans
    1 (11 ounce) can niblet corn
    1 (11 ounce) can Rotel tomatoes & chilies
    1 (28 ounce) can diced tomatoes
    1 (4 ounce) can diced green chilies
    1 (1 1/4 ounce) envelope taco seasoning mix
    1 (1 ounce) envelope hidden valley ranch dressing mix
    1 lb shredded chicken, ground beef or any meat

    Directions
    Cook meat and drain.
    Shred if needed.
    Add all ingredients to crock pot.
    DO NOT DRAIN CANS.
    Stir.
    Cook on high for 2 hours or low for 4 hours.
    Keep on low until serving to keep hot.
    Garnish with sour cream, shredded cheese, chopped green onions, or tortilla chips.

    Taco soup
    1-or 1 1/2 lbs hamburger meat
    1-chopped onion
    1-can tomatoes
    2-cans rotel (i use one can rotel and another can tomatoes)
    1-pkg.taco mix
    1-pkg.ranch dressing mix
    1-cup water
    1-can corn or hominy(i use corn)
    2-cans beans(i use 1 pinto and one dark red kidney beans)
    salt and pepper to taste

    Brown hambuger meat and onion (drain)
    Add rest of ingredients and cook 30 to 45 minutes

    Mine is slightly different:

    meat
    salsa
    corn
    broth/bullion
    oregano
    chili powder
    onion
    garlic
    cooked rice
    beans
    can of diced tomatoes (or several)

    Add in the the broth, can of tomatoes, meat, onion, garlic, spices, salsa, and beans to a pot and let it cook. When it has simmered for a while, add in the rice and the corn and let them heat up. Serve with crushed tortilla chips, a sprinkling of cheese, and a dollop of sour cream.

    NOTES:
    There are no amounts. I cook soup in a 5 gallon soup pot and soup is a "leftover bits" meal.

    The meat can be leftover chicken, leftover taco meat, leftover sloppy joes, or a mixture of leftover taco meat and sloppy joes. It just depends on what I have on hand to use.
